There are two styles of Evoque mirrors so did you try the right ones? In 2013 there was a minor facelift and the mirrors were redesigned to increase the gap between the A pillar and the mirror surround after lots of complaints about a huge blind spot. 2020 Pangea Green 1st Edition D240 New Defender 110 is here and loving it
